Comprehending Cryptocurrency Exchange Fees
Before diving into the specifics, it's vital to comprehend the kinds of fees associated with crypto exchanges:
Trading Fees: The fee charged when purchasing or selling cryptocurrency. It's often a portion of the overall trade size and can differ for market makers and takers.
Withdrawal Fees: Fees charged when withdrawing cryptocurrencies from the exchange to an external wallet. This can vary substantially depending upon the asset.
Deposit Fees: While lots of exchanges don't charge for deposits, some do, specifically for credit card transactions or bank transfers.
Inactivity Fees: These are fees charged for not trading within a specific timeframe.

When selecting a crypto exchange, traders must think about more than simply fees. Here are key characteristics to search for:
Security: Look for exchanges with a strong track record and security steps in location, such as two-factor authentication and cold storage of funds.
User Experience: An user-friendly interface ends up being important, especially for novices.
Liquidity: Higher liquidity outcomes in less slippage and simpler execution of trades.
Possession Selection: More coins may supply higher chances but can likewise complicate the trading process.
Geographical Restrictions: Ensure the exchange runs in your country and abide by local policies.

What is the average trading fee on crypto exchanges?
The typical trading fee on crypto exchanges varies from 0.1% to 0.5%. Nevertheless, users can often lower fees through commitment programs or by trading specific pairs.
2. Exist exchanges without any trading fees?
Some exchanges provide zero trading fees for particular cryptocurrencies; however, they may charge greater withdrawal fees or other service charge.
